返回
如何优化下拉菜单,提升用户交互体验?
见解分享
2023-10-21 05:36:01
在当今数字化时代,下拉菜单作为一种重要的用户界面元素,无处不在,从电子商务网站到复杂的软件应用程序。它们提供了一种简便、直观的方式来筛选和选择选项,极大地提升了用户交互体验。然而,设计和实现下拉菜单时,需要考虑诸多因素,以确保它们高效、用户友好且符合最佳实践。
清晰的设计原则
一个好的下拉菜单从设计伊始就应遵循清晰的原则,以确保其易于理解和使用。
- 清晰的标签: 下拉菜单的标签应简明扼要,准确反映菜单的内容。避免使用模棱两可或含糊不清的措辞。
- 可视化层级: 下拉菜单应清楚地显示其在页面或应用程序中的位置。使用不同的背景色或边框来区分它与其他元素。
- 一致性: 在整个应用程序或网站中保持下拉菜单的一致性。这有助于建立用户熟悉度并减少混乱。
卓越的可用性
可用性是下拉菜单设计的关键方面。它们应易于访问、导航和使用。
- 明确的触发器: 用户应能够轻松识别下拉菜单的触发器(如按钮或链接)。将其设计得与周围环境有明显区别。
- 平滑的交互: 下拉菜单的打开和关闭应平滑、直观。避免突然出现或消失,这可能会干扰用户。
- 可预测的行为: 用户应能够预测下拉菜单中的选项的顺序和组织方式。使用逻辑顺序并提供明确的视觉线索。
无障碍可访问性
下拉菜单的设计还应考虑可访问性,确保残障人士能够轻松使用。
- 键盘导航: 下拉菜单应使用键盘进行导航,允许用户使用 Tab 键和方向键在选项之间移动。
- 屏幕阅读器支持: 下拉菜单应与屏幕阅读器兼容,向视障用户提供相同的信息和交互。
- 色彩对比: 下拉菜单的文本和背景应具有足够的色彩对比度,以确保可读性。
技术实现技巧
помимо вышеперечисленных принципов проектирования и удобства использования следует также учитывать технические аспекты реализации раскрывающихся меню.
- 响应式设计: 下拉菜单应在各种设备和屏幕尺寸上良好运行,包括台式机、笔记本电脑和移动设备。
- 加载时间: 下拉菜单应快速加载,避免让用户等待。使用异步加载技术来优化性能。
- 错误处理: 下拉菜单应优雅地处理错误情况,例如选项不可用或数据加载失败。
示例代码
以下是一个 HTML 和 CSS 代码示例,演示了一个基本的下拉菜单:
<label for="dropdown">选择一个选项:</label>
<select id="dropdown">
<option value="1">选项 1</option>
<option value="2">选项 2</option>
<option value="3">选项 3</option>
</select>
#dropdown {
width: 200px;
height: 30px;
padding: 5px;
border: 1px solid #ccc;
}
#dropdown option {
padding: 5px;
}
结论
通过遵循这些最佳实践,您可以设计和实现有效、用户友好且符合可访问性标准的下拉菜单。这些元素将无缝集成到您的用户界面中,提升整体用户交互体验。记住,不断测试和改进您的下拉菜单至关重要,以确保它们始终提供最佳的可用性和可访问性。